Hobbes: The walking pharmacy
Due to an ever increasing list of illnesses, Hobbes now has to take more medicine than any cat should have to deal with.
Morning
- 5mg Prednisolone
- 5mg Felimazole
- 1ml Zantac
- 1ml Antepsin
Afternoon
- 2.5mg Felimazole
- 1ml Zantac
- 1ml Antepsin
Evening
- 1ml Antepsin
Unsurprisingly, he doesn’t like me very much at the moment as everytime he comes near me, I thrown another handful of pills or squirt a foul tasting liquid into the back of his throat.
Also none of this comes cheap. Today’s trip to the vet cost me about the same as the Kenko Pro 300 DG 1.4X Teleconverter I had planned to order at the end of the month. That’ll have to wait a bit longer I think.

Sympathy for Hobbes (and my credit card)
Hobbes isn’t well. In addition to the existing FIV and thyroid problem, he’s now got either lymphoma or adenocarcinoma, we should know more tomorrow when we get the result of the biopsy. If it’s lympoma apparently it can be treated to an extent with Prednisolone, if it’s adenocarcinoma it can’t be treated.
He spent the day at the vets today for tests and came home minus large patches of fur where they’d taken blood and done an ultrasound scan. There was of course the astronomical bill to go with it. He is at least eating food again which is something he’s not done for nearly a week.
